Job Description

Purpose

The Sourcer & Talent Insights Specialist will execute sourcing strategies for critical roles across the R&D function and lead the delivery of external talent insights & market intelligence projects to inform hiring and wider talent attraction strategies. You will act as a true talent advisor to the business, leveraging talent intelligence tools and data analysis techniques to deliver meaningful insights that inform talent strategy and enable future capability building.

Responsibilities

  • Lead on the development and presentation of external talent insights to the business to address challenges, support recruitment planning and inform talent strategy across R&D.
  • Develop & present complex talent mapping projects, providing insight into external talent availability and opportunities for talent attraction.
  • Provide strategic sourcing support on critical open roles. Serve as a sourcing leader and insights expert, leveraging research & data analysis techniques to provide recommendations to business leaders, Recruiters, and Business HR.
  • Set vision, strategy, and goals for all aspects of proactive sourcing strategies across aligned functions in R&D.
  • Partner with key stakeholders to build talent pipelines ahead of gaps/vacancies. Will develop sourcing strategies that will target critical, high-level talent in highly competitive and challenging markets.
  • Developing deep expertise and seeking continuous learning in-focus areas, with the ability to understand and speak in detail about functions, culture, and role responsibilities, showcasing AbbVie’s Employee Value Proposition.
  • Proactively source passive candidates through advanced search techniques including Boolean search on social media, LinkedIn, SeekOut, and industry directories to uncover high quality talent pools.
  • Conduct thorough candidate prescreening and facilitate presentation to hiring managers and recruiting team using various Talent Acquisition platforms to maintain/retain accuracy, quality, and integrity of data.
  • Nurture Professional pipelines by keeping talent engaged as roles are posted and provide information regarding available opportunities.
  • Providing updates and reporting on critical roles and sourcing activities to stakeholders and reporting.
  • Develop strong partnerships with Recruiters and candidates to build a qualified candidate bench to meet current and anticipated business needs.
  • Build trust and strong partnerships with internal stakeholders, including business leaders, Recruiters, Total Rewards, and Talent Development, and Business HR to understand the key roles and challenges to overcome to secure top talent.

Qualifications

Education and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ree required.
  • Minimum of 3 years in a dedicated in-house sourcing role or retained search role; 5+ years preferred.
  • Talent sourcing experience in the Healthcare/Pharmaceutical industry preferred. Prior experience sourcing for R&D roles/functions advantageous.
  • Strong track record in research methods & external talent landscape analysis. Must have experience in the creation and delivery of complex talent mappings & external talent insights projects for clients/key stakeholders at leadership levels.
  • Ability to create and execute sourcing strategies for critical roles, leveraging available tools, platforms, and research techniques to identify talent. 
  • Strong experience in successful screening; initial contact, prescreening, and interviewing, both in-depth phone and face-to-face with candidates.
  • Experienced in developing & executing on proactive recruiting strategies including confidential searches. 
  • Strong accountability and proactivity, demonstrating a consistent track record of results, often in the face of challenges or obstacles. 
  • Proficient in using CRM to enhance sourcing and candidate management processes.
